One of the most famous homes in North America that has had its horrific story told numerous times in novels and movies for decades. Is the site of what has become almost folklore. A home, that’s image, has been burned into the minds of Gen Xers ever since their youth. A site of murder, mystery and the paranormal. Today, we’ll discuss the story of, The Amityville House.
